An income withholding order (IWO) is an order that directs you (the employer) to withhold a specific amount from the paychecks of an employee. The withholding amounts are used to pay child support, spousal support, medical support, or other types of support.

WebAug 5, 2024 · A fringe benefit is a form of pay for the performance of services. For example, you provide an employee with a fringe benefit when you allow the employee to use a business vehicle to commute to and from work. Fringe benefits are generally included in an employee's gross income (there are some exceptions). It includes people who are unable to find jobs as well as some who are no longer looking for work and those who are working fewer … WebDec 9, 2024 · The relationship between consumption and income is called propensity to consume or consumption function. 1. C=f (Y). Consumption function may be represented by an equation. C=a+b (Y) C=consumption, a =consumption at zero level of income b=MPC (slope of the consumption curve) Y=income.
